S4 E2: Getting to the Olympics with Emmet Brennan

An Olympian Boxer! 

Emmett Brennan represented Ireland in Olympics in Tokyo in boxing! But it was not an easy journey at all for Emmet, he has several obstacles in his way, at one point he even walked away from boxing but came back fighting to than face several injuries, depression, illness in family and so much more. This truly the story of SHOW UP, WORK HARD and you will prevail. 

This is not just an episode about boxing, it is so much! It is about determination in sports, life and business. It is about speaking up the truth about how you are feeling and putting measures into place to help yourself! 

And as always I like to look at the full picture. Emmet explains to me the physical and financial trials and tribulations of trying to make it as a boxer in Olympics and explains how a credit union loan is what got him there at a time!
